In the village of Choanla, some 12,000 feet high in the mountains of San Marcos, church members are excited about the new construction project that has begun. There old, damp mud brick church building is being replaced by a new concrete one.

This is the pastor and his family at Choanla. Please pray that we can finish the construction before the rain begins in May. Work is hard because of the terrain and the altitude.
We continue the construction on the church at Catarina and all is going well. David West, was with us a few weeks ago there with Wynne Baptist Church. David's wife, Lisa, had breast cancer 6 months ago and now it has returned. Please pray for David and Lisa as they walk through this valley.
